I am moving some documents from M$ Word to my home computer that uses Debian 
Linux.  The document in question was saved in the RTF format from Word and 
then re-opened in OOo Writer.  The issue with the document is margin-spacing.

I wish to have a document-wide left and right margin of one (1) inch.  
Selecting All (ctrl-A) and then adjusting the margins does not move the 
margins to a document-wide setting.  I suspect this is because in Word, the 
document had many "Section Break, Next Page"-marks thus causing many 
different margin settings to exist.  This should be easy to correct, now that 
I know the probable cause.
